Under the ACA, dental care is an essential health benefit for children but not for adults. Douglas County has 81 Marketplace health plans from five insurers for 2026 (Ambetter Health,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Nebraska and 3 others), and none of them has to cover adult dental care.

How Dental Networks Work in Douglas County

Before you choose a plan in Douglas County, look up your dentist in the plan’s own provider directory and call the office to confirm it is in the specific network the plan uses. Networks change, and a practice can be in one insurer’s network but not another’s.

The first choice is PPO or HMO. A dental HMO usually has the lower premium but only pays network dentists, often through an assigned office; a dental PPO still pays something out of network, which matters if your current dentist isn’t in any HMO near Douglas County.

Your Dental Benefits Explained

One plan Daniel places, SecureDental PLUS, shows the trade-offs: its lowest tier covers major care only at a discount, its top tier pays 70% for major care and orthodontia, and yearly maximums run from $1,000 to $2,000. The dental insurance guide compares the tiers.

If you already need a crown, the waiting period matters more than the premium. HealthCare.gov notes that separate dental plans can have waiting periods for adults, and SecureDental PLUS, for example, waits 12 months for major care and 1 month for basic care.

A dental plan pays dentists, not emergency rooms. If a tooth infection or a facial injury takes you to an emergency department, that bill goes to your health insurance. How to Get Dental Coverage in Douglas County

Buying dental through HealthCare.gov means buying a health plan in the same application, so the choice in Douglas County starts with its 81 health plans from Ambetter Health,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Nebraska and 3 others. Outside the Marketplace there is no enrollment window for stand-alone dental, and coverage usually starts the first of the next month. For the self-employed, dental premiums usually qualify for the self-employed health insurance deduction. It lowers income tax, not self-employment tax, is capped at the business’s net profit, and is lost for any month you could have joined an employer-subsidized plan. Health premiums usually dominate it; in Douglas County a 40-year-old’s 2026 benchmark Silver plan is $642 a month before any tax credit.

Keep the category straight: dental insurance is an excepted benefit, not minimum essential coverage, so it sits alongside a health plan rather than replacing one.
